2014-01-15 2 views

답변

19

이 답변은보다 완벽한 answer from user2968356입니다.

이 대답을 완료하려면 .sublime-package 파일이 아카이브이므로 ZIP 유틸리티를 사용하여 압축을 풀 수 있습니다. 패키지의 Default.sublime-keymap을 편집 할 필요가 없으며 키 바인딩을 복사하여 ->키 바인딩 - 사용자 하위 텍스트의에서 사용 가능한 Default.sublime-keymap으로 수정하여 추가 할 수 있습니다.

그리고 바로 가기를 제공하기 위해이 여기 XDebug가 패키지의 결합을 기본 열쇠, 마음대로 수정 : 최대 사용자의

{"keys": ["ctrl+f8"], "command": "xdebug_breakpoint"}, 
{"keys": ["shift+f8"], "command": "xdebug_conditional_breakpoint"}, 
{"keys": ["ctrl+shift+f5"], "command": "xdebug_continue", "args": {"command": "run"}}, 
{"keys": ["ctrl+shift+f6"], "command": "xdebug_continue", "args": {"command": "step_over"}}, 
{"keys": ["ctrl+shift+f7"], "command": "xdebug_continue", "args": {"command": "step_into"}}, 
{"keys": ["ctrl+shift+f8"], "command": "xdebug_continue", "args": {"command": "step_out"}}, 
{"keys": ["ctrl+shift+f9"], "command": "xdebug_session_start"}, 
{"keys": ["ctrl+shift+f10"], "command": "xdebug_session_stop"}, 
{"keys": ["ctrl+shift+f11"], "command": "xdebug_layout", "args": {"keymap" : true}} 
2

숭고한 메뉴에서 Preferences -> Browse Packages...으로 이동하십시오.

이렇게하면 Packages 폴더가 열립니다. 한 폴더로 돌아 가면 Installed Packages이라는 다른 폴더가 나타납니다.

일반적으로 패키지 컨트롤을 통해 설치 한 패키지 이름에 따라 xdebug에 대해 .sublime-package을 찾습니다.

내부에는 모든 키 바인딩을 보유하는 Default.sublime-keymap 파일이 있습니다.

필요에 따라 변경하고 저장하고 다시 시작하십시오.


환호, 이것이 도움이되기를 바랍니다!

0

, 당신은 어떤 '최고'와 'Ctrl'키를 대체 할 수 있습니다 명령 키. 내 설정은 다음과 같습니다.

[ 
    {"keys": ["super+f16"], "command": "xdebug_breakpoint"}, 
    {"keys": ["shift+f16"], "command": "xdebug_conditional_breakpoint"}, 
    {"keys": ["super+shift+f5"], "command": "xdebug_continue", "args": {"command": "run"}}, 
    {"keys": ["super+f13"], "command": "xdebug_continue", "args": {"command": "step_over"}}, 
    {"keys": ["super+f14"], "command": "xdebug_continue", "args": {"command": "step_into"}}, 
    {"keys": ["super+f15"], "command": "xdebug_continue", "args": {"command": "step_out"}}, 
    {"keys": ["super+shift+f9"], "command": "xdebug_session_start"}, 
    {"keys": ["super+shift+f17"], "command": "xdebug_session_stop"}, 
    {"keys": ["super+shift+f18"], "command": "xdebug_layout", "args": {"keymap" : true}} 
] 
관련 문제